Palak paneer (pronounced [paːlək pəniːɾ]) is a vegetarian dish originating from the Indian subcontinent, consisting of paneer (a type of cottage cheese) in a thick paste made from puréed spinach. green coloured palak curry is palak paneer with paneer cubes, garam masala and other spices. finally, i request you to check my other top paneer curries recipes collection with this post of palak. Instructions to make Palak Paneer:
- Heat up a pan (medium heat) and add 1 tbsp oil.
- Once the oil is hot, add cumin seeds and let them splutter for about 10 seconds.
- Add bay leaf, grated ginger, sliced garlic cloves, and chopped serrano peppers and stir for about 30 seconds.
- Add chopped onion and salt, and stir until the onions turn pink to light brown. Caution: Don't overcook the onions to dark brown.
- Add chopped tomatoes and cook until the tomatoes soften up and become a bit mushy.
- Turn down the heat, and let the pan cool down a bit.
- Add whisked yogurt and spices (turmeric powder, red chili powder, cumin powder and coriander powder) and cook on low-medium heat until the mixture comes to a boil (bubbles on the side in yogurt). Keep stirring in between.
- Add chopped spinach and mix it well. Cook for a few minutes until the spinach wilts.
- Add coriander leaves to the mixture and cook for about a minute or two.
- Turn off the heat and let the mixture cool down.
- Blend the cooked mixture into a fine paste/puree.
- Pour the puree back to the pan (on low-medium flame) then add 3/4 tbsp whipped cream.
- Grate some paneer into the puree, and after about a minute add one inch cubes.
- Top off with some more (1/4 tbsp) whipped cream.
- Palak paneer is ready to serve!
